Are people in Lewiston older or younger than people in Carey?
- The Median Age in Lewiston is 10.6 years older than in Carey.

Are housing costs cheaper in Lewiston or Carey?
- Lewiston housing costs are 14.7% less expensive than Carey hous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Lewiston or Carey?
- The average commute for residents of Lewiston is 5.1 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Carey.
